Any opinions on this product? I have read some pretty bad things about AA but that doesn't necessarily mean that all of their products are bad. Here is what it says on their website:

"What are the ingredients in Armor All® Protectants? Do they include silicone, alcohol, ultraviolet inhibitors and petroleum distillates?
Armor All® Leather Care contains lanolin and natural moisturizers, and UV inhibitors. Armor All® Leather Care Protectant Spray and Leather Wipes contain water-based silicone emulsions, surfactants, and ultraviolet light inhibitors. Armor All® Original Shine Protectant contains water-based silicone emulsions, surfactants, and ultraviolet light inhibitors, humectants, dispersants and gloss enhancers. Armor All® Ultimate Clean Protectant contains water-based silicone emulsions, surfactants, ultraviolet light inhibitors and a fragrance."

Note that it does not say what the GEL specifically contains so I don't know what to think. 18 oz. bottle sells for $5.87 at Walmart so this might be a cheaper alternative to the top quality products. That is, if it's safe to use and is decent quality. I have tinted windows and my car used to be garaged but no longer. By black leather is exposed much more now and I would like to take better care of it. Anyone know if this product is safe/effective? I could not find a review on it anywhere. Keep in mind I am talking about the GEL, not the older regular "leather care".

I actually decided to go ahead and purchase to test it out on 2 Lexus vehicles. I am almost certain they both have finished/coated leather. So far, I can say product smells nice (pretty neutral scent), seems to absorb into the leather nicely, and doesn't leave too much shine. Leather looks clean and pretty natural. Mine is 03' with black leather and is in good condition (tinted and I used products). Mom's is 02' with tan leather and it is slightly dry/hardened in some areas. I would like to see if this product will actually restore/moisturize her tan leather but it may be some time before I see any remarkable difference.
